Is Fazakerley a nice place to live?
Fazakerley is a passable place to live. We've given it a liveable rating of C+. However, one concern might be the high levels of unemployment in the area. With fewer homeowners than average, the area may feel less settled for those seeking an established community.
How safe is Fazakerley?
Fazakerley has an average crime rate of 162.5 crimes per 1,000 people, similar to most areas. Crime hotspots have been reported near Cardinal Gardens, as reported by Merseyside Police.
What are the best schools in Fazakerley?
Fazakerley has 37 schools nearby. The top-rated Ofsted Outstanding schools include Holy Rosary Catholic Primary School, Florence Melly Community Primary School, St Matthew's Catholic Primary School. Other well-regarded schools rated Good by Ofsted include Aintree Davenhill Primary School and Our Lady and St Philomena's Catholic Primary School. Note: 2 schools are currently rated as Requires Improvement.
What are the demographics of Fazakerley?
The majority of residents in Fazakerley identify as White (British) (85%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(89%). The most common religion is Christian (65%).
